  • Abstract
    Multimedia transmission is an important component of the Web-based robotic applications which often serve multiple users concurrently. However, the multimedia transmission in large networks such as Internet is suffered from the hugeness and heterogeneity of the users. In this paper, an adaptive transmission strategy based on MLDA is designed to accommodate with the multicast environment. Improvement to MLDA is proposed for applications of the Web-based robotic system, as in the behaviors of the multimedia sender and receiver, synchronization mechanism and estimation of TCP-friendly transmission rate. Finally, a preliminary simulation for the estimation of TCP-friendly transmission rate is demonstrated.
